Cement siding services involve the installation, repair, and replacement of siding made from cement-based materials. This type of siding provides a durable exterior finish that can withstand harsh weather conditions, resist pests, and require minimal maintenance. Contractors specializing in cement siding can help homeowners select the right style and color to enhance the appearance of their property while ensuring the installation is properly secured and sealed. Proper installation is key to maximizing the lifespan and performance of cement siding, making it a practical choice for many residential properties.

Cement siding helps address common problems such as cracking, warping, or rotting that can occur with other siding materials like wood or vinyl.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, or pests can weaken exterior walls, leading to costly repairs or compromised insulation. Installing cement siding can act as a protective barrier, preventing moisture infiltration and reducing the risk of damage caused by pests or rot.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ement siding repairs range from $250 to $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this category involve patching or replacing small sections and tend to fall within the lower to middle price ranges. Fewer repairs require extensive work that pushes costs higher.

Standard Installation - Replacing existing cement siding with new panels generally costs between $1,500 and $4,000 for many homes. This range covers most mid-sized projects and includes materials and labor. Larger or more complex installations can reach $5,000+ but are less common.

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ding overhauls for larger properties typically fall between $8,000 and $15,000. Many projects in this range involve significant removal and installation work, with costs increasing for custom or high-end materials. Fewer projects exceed this upper range.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ive siding work, such as multi-story buildings or custom designs, can reach $20,000 or more. While these high-end projects are less frequent, local contractors are equipped to handle complex jobs within this budget range. Costs vary depending on scope and specifications.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is cement siding? Cement siding is a durable exterior cladding material made from a mixture of cement, sand, and cellulose fibers, designed to mimic the appearance of traditional materials like wood or stone.

What are the benefits of cement siding? Cement siding offers resistance to pests, fire, and weather elements, along with low maintenance requirements and a long lifespan for exterior protection.

Can cement siding be customized? Yes, local contractors can provide cement siding in various styles, textures, and colors to match different aesthetic preferences and architectural styles.

Is cement siding suitable for all climates? Cement siding is generally suitable for a wide range of climates due to its durability and resistance to moisture, temperature changes, and pests.

How do local service providers install cement siding? Local contractors typically prepare the surface, then securely attach the cement siding panels using appropriate fasteners, ensuring proper alignment and weatherproofing.
